On 3/23/2022 11:15 AM, Giovanni Bracco (giovanni.bracco@enea.it) wrote:
> In the documentation for the CellServDB file (both client & server)
> https://docs.openafs.org/Reference/5/CellServDB.html
>
> it is declared that is the "fully qualified hostname"
> that must be provided in the line defining a dbserver.

The specified DNS hostname can either be an A record or a CNAME record.

The hostname is only used by the Windows Cache Manager, Windows
authentication provider, and Windows network provider.

All of the command line tools, the UNIX cache manager, and the servers
only use the specified IP address.
